PHP ADODB生成HTML表格函数rs2html功能【附错误处理函数用法】


Posted in PHP onMay 29, 2018

本文实例讲述了PHP ADODB生成HTML表格函数rs2html功能。分享给大家供大家参考,具体如下:

一、代码

adodb.inc.php可从官方网站http://adodb.sourceforge.net/ 下载。

或者点击此处本站下载

conn.php:

<?php
  include_once ('../adodb5/adodb.inc.php');
  $conn = ADONewConnection('mysql');
  $conn -> PConnect('localhost','root','root','db_database14');
  $conn -> execute('set names gb2312');
  $ADODB_FETCH_MODE = ADODB_FETCH_BOTH;
?>

rs2html.php:

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>应用rs2html()函数直接输出返回的结果集</title>
<style type="text/css">
<!--
TH {
background-color:#FFFFFF;
  font-size: 12px;
  color: #FF0000;
}
td {
background-color:#FFFFFF;
  font-size: 12px;
  color: #FF0000;
}
-->
</style></head>
<body>
<?php
  include_once 'conn/conn.php';  //载入数据库链接文件
  include_once '../adodb5/tohtml.inc.php';  //载入tohtml.inc.php文件
  $rst = $conn -> execute('select * from tb_object');  //返回查询结果集
  rs2html($rst,' width="350" border="1" cellpadding="1" cellspacing="1" bordercolor="#FFFFFF" bgcolor="#FF0000"',array('序号','类别','添加时间'));  //输出结果集
?>
</body>
</html>

二、运行结果

PHP ADODB生成HTML表格函数rs2html功能【附错误处理函数用法】

附:ADODB错误处理函数

<?php
  include_once 'conn/conn.php';  //载入数据库链接文件
  $conn -> debug = true;  //开启调试
  $sql = 'select * form tb_object';  //sql查询语句
  $rst = $conn -> execute($sql) or die($conn -> errorMsg());    //调用查询语句
?>

运行结果:

PHP ADODB生成HTML表格函数rs2html功能【附错误处理函数用法】

希望本文所述对大家PHP程序设计有所帮助。

PHP 相关文章推荐
搜索和替换文件或目录的一个好类--很实用
Oct 09 PHP
PHP MVC模式在网站架构中的实现分析
Mar 04 PHP
《PHP编程最快明白》第四讲:日期、表单接收、session、cookie
Nov 01 PHP
php URL跳转代码 减少外链
Jun 25 PHP
深入php socket的讲解与实例分析
Jun 13 PHP
PHP超牛逼无限极分类生成树方法
May 11 PHP
怎样搭建PHP开发环境
Jul 28 PHP
PHP实现长文章分页实例代码(附源码)
Feb 03 PHP
php 如何获取文件的后缀名
Jun 05 PHP
Yii净化器CHtmlPurifier用法示例(过滤不良代码)
Jul 15 PHP
PHP面向对象学习之parent::关键字
Jan 18 PHP
PHP中通过getopt解析GNU C风格命令行选项
Nov 18 PHP
PHP ADODB生成下拉列表框功能示例
May 29 #PHP
Laravel实现短信注册的示例代码
May 29 #PHP
PHP abstract 抽象类定义与用法示例
May 29 #PHP
thinkPHP中U方法加密传递参数功能示例
May 29 #PHP
在Laravel中使用DataTables插件的方法
May 29 #PHP
ThinkPHP实现的rsa非对称加密类示例
May 29 #PHP
PHP中实现中文字串截取无乱码的解决方法
May 29 #PHP
You might like
php调用c接口无错版介绍
2014/03/11 PHP
php项目开发中用到的快速排序算法分析
2016/06/25 PHP
PHP Filter过滤器全面解析
2016/08/09 PHP
php调用云片网接口发送短信的实现方法
2017/10/25 PHP
laravel5实现微信第三方登录功能
2018/12/06 PHP
TP5.0框架实现无限极回复功能的方法分析
2019/05/04 PHP
PHP pthreads v3下的Volatile简介与使用方法示例
2020/02/21 PHP
php中使用array_filter()函数过滤数组实例讲解
2021/03/03 PHP
过虑特殊字符输入的js代码
2010/08/05 Javascript
jquery获取及设置outerhtml的方法
2015/03/09 Javascript
纯js实现无限空间大小的本地存储
2015/06/18 Javascript
bootstrap3 兼容IE8浏览器!
2016/05/02 Javascript
原生JS实现九宫格抽奖效果
2017/04/01 Javascript
微信小程序request请求后台接口php的实例详解
2017/09/20 Javascript
vue拦截器实现统一token,并兼容IE9验证功能
2018/04/26 Javascript
JavaScript实现封闭区域布尔运算的示例代码
2018/06/25 Javascript
vue中设置、获取、删除cookie的方法
2018/09/21 Javascript
JavaScript鼠标拖拽事件详解
2020/04/03 Javascript
[44:41]Fnatic vs Liquid 2018国际邀请赛小组赛BO2 第二场 8.16
2018/08/17 DOTA
用smtplib和email封装python发送邮件模块类分享
2014/02/17 Python
python 根据正则表达式提取指定的内容实例详解
2016/12/04 Python
基于Python实现的微信好友数据分析
2018/02/26 Python
对python中的logger模块全面讲解
2018/04/28 Python
Python快速查找list中相同部分的方法
2018/06/27 Python
linux查找当前python解释器的位置方法
2019/02/20 Python
python 通过可变参数计算n个数的乘积方法
2019/06/13 Python
pyqt5 QScrollArea设置在自定义侧(任何位置)
2019/09/25 Python
python实现多进程按序号批量修改文件名的方法示例
2019/12/30 Python
解决Keras自带数据集与预训练model下载太慢问题
2020/06/12 Python
HearthSong官网:儿童户外玩具、儿童益智玩具
2017/10/16 全球购物
马来西亚太阳镜、眼镜和隐形眼镜网上商店:Focus Point
2018/12/13 全球购物
计算机专业求职信
2014/06/02 职场文书
公司备用金管理制度
2015/08/04 职场文书
消防安全培训工作总结
2015/10/23 职场文书
七年级之开学家长寄语35句
2019/09/05 职场文书
配置nginx负载均衡
2022/05/06 Servers